Understanding the Regulatory Landscape
One of the most critical factors influencing the credibility of an online gaming platform is its regulatory status. Reputable operators are often licensed by recognized authorities such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), UK Gambling Commission, or Gibraltar Regulatory Authority. Licensing ensures adherence to strict standards of fairness, anti-money laundering procedures, and player protection measures.
Platforms that operate without appropriate licensing usually lack transparency and are more susceptible to unethical practices. Consequently, verifying a platform’s regulatory status is a primary step for players seeking a trustworthy environment. A reliable platform will typically publish its licensing information visibly on its website.

The Role of Fair Play and Random Number Generators (RNGs)
Ensuring fair play is fundamental in online gaming. Most licensed operators employ certified Random Number Generators (RNGs) that are regularly tested by independent auditors such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s to verify fairness. Transparent reporting and certification provide reassurance that game outcomes are genuinely random and not manipulated.
Emerging Trends and Responsible Gaming
- Mobile Optimization: Increasingly, players access platforms via smartphones, prompting operators to develop mobile-friendly interfaces.
- Live Dealer Games: Fusion of online convenience with real-world interaction enhances engagement and trust.
- Responsible Gaming Tools: Features like self-exclusion, deposit limits, and time reminders help players maintain healthy gambling habits.
